Wegmans spiral ham cooking instructions.

Water-Cooking. Place in a large roasting pan, skin-side down and cover with cool water. Bring water to 190 degrees (not quite simmering). Cook to 163 degrees internal temperature (or about 25 minutes per pound). Add water to keep ham covered. Take ham from the pan and while warm, remove the skin and fat as desired.

Add to Cart. Deli. Organic. Organic.Something went wrong... OK. Skip to content OVEN: Preheat oven to 275 degrees. Remove outer wrapping and bone guard from ham. Place ham sliced side down in shallow roasting pan with 1/2 inch water covering bottom of pan. Cover and heat 12-15 minutes per pound. Carefully remove from oven and let rest 20-30 minutes. Serve immediately. Ham is fully cooked and can be served hot or cold. Follow heating instructions for ham. Prepare glaze 15 minutes prior to the end of cooking. To prepare glaze: 1. Ten minutes prior to removing ham from oven after heating, remove ham from oven and increase oven temperature to 400 degrees F. Cover ham with 6 to 8 ounces of honey, sprinkle glaze over honey coated ham until completely covered. Return ham to oven for 10 minutes; Remove ham and serve

Whether you wrap the ham lightly, tightly, or include the entire pan, the idea behind using foil is the same -- to seal in the steam and the juices to create a moister, better-tasting ham.
